What is Decentralized Finance (DeFi)?
Decentralized Finance refers to a broad category of financial services that are developed and deployed on public blockchains. Its primary objective is to replicate and improve upon traditional financial systems without relying on centralized institutions. Instead, DeFi leverages blockchain networks, decentralized applications (dApps), and self-executing smart contracts to provide financial services directly to users.
For example, in traditional banking, an individual who wishes to borrow money must rely on a bank to assess their creditworthiness, approve the loan, and manage repayment. In DeFi, however, lending and borrowing occur directly between users through decentralized platforms. Smart contracts automate the process, enforcing rules and ensuring collateralization without the need for human intermediaries.
In essence, DeFi creates an open financial ecosystem that is accessible to anyone with an internet connection and a digital wallet. Its decentralized nature ensures that no single entity holds control, fostering inclusivity and democratizing access to financial opportunities.
How DeFi Works: The Technology Behind It
The functionality of DeFi relies on several key technological components that collectively ensure its efficiency, security, and decentralization.
Blockchain and Smart Contracts
At its core, DeFi operates on blockchain technology. Ethereum, the most widely used blockchain for DeFi, provides a secure, transparent, and programmable infrastructure. Transactions are recorded on the blockchain, ensuring immutability and traceability.
Smart contracts, which are self-executing code deployed on blockchains, automate financial processes. For instance, a smart contract governing a lending protocol specifies rules such as interest rates, collateral requirements, and repayment terms. Once conditions are met, the contract executes automatically, eliminating the need for intermediaries.
Decentralized Applications (dApps)
DeFi services are offered through decentralized applications that run on blockchains. Unlike conventional financial apps hosted on centralized servers, dApps operate across distributed networks, enhancing security and minimizing risks of censorship or downtime. Examples include Uniswap for decentralized trading and Aave for decentralized lending.
Tokens and Stablecoins
Tokens represent digital assets within the DeFi ecosystem. These include utility tokens, governance tokens, and stablecoins. Stablecoins, such as DAI, USDC, and USDT, play a critical role by providing stability against the volatility of cryptocurrencies. They are typically pegged to fiat currencies, allowing users to engage in DeFi transactions without being exposed to drastic price fluctuations.
Key Features of DeFi
DeFi is distinguished from traditional finance by several defining features:

Transparency and Accessibility – All transactions are publicly recorded on blockchains, enabling users to independently verify them. This eliminates the opacity commonly associated with banks and financial institutions.
Permissionless Participation – Anyone with an internet connection and a digital wallet can access DeFi platforms, regardless of geography, income level, or financial history.
Interoperability and Composability – DeFi platforms are designed as “money legos,” meaning different applications can be combined to create new financial products. For example, users can deposit funds into a lending platform, earn tokens in return, and then use those tokens in another platform to generate further yields.
Security and Control – Users maintain full control of their assets through their wallets, reducing reliance on custodians. Funds are not held by banks but remain under user control until smart contracts execute transactions.
Key Applications of DeFi
DeFi encompasses a wide range of applications that replicate and enhance traditional financial services.
Lending and Borrowing
DeFi lending platforms such as Aave, Compound, and MakerDAO allow users to lend cryptocurrencies and earn interest, or borrow assets by collateralizing their holdings. Unlike banks, these platforms operate 24/7 and do not require credit checks.
For instance, a user holding Ethereum (ETH) can deposit it into Compound and borrow stablecoins like DAI against it. This system provides liquidity without forcing users to sell their assets.
Decentralized Exchanges (DEXs)
Platforms such as Uniswap, SushiSwap, and Curve enable peer-to-peer trading of cryptocurrencies. Unlike centralized exchanges, which hold custody of user funds, DEXs allow traders to retain control of their wallets. Automated Market Makers (AMMs) facilitate trading by using liquidity pools instead of traditional order books.
Yield Farming and Liquidity Mining
Yield farming allows users to maximize returns by providing liquidity to DeFi platforms and earning rewards in the form of tokens. Liquidity mining further incentivizes participants by offering governance tokens, granting them voting rights in protocol decisions.
Stablecoins
Stablecoins are a cornerstone of DeFi, enabling stable transactions and mitigating crypto volatility. DAI, issued by MakerDAO, is decentralized and backed by collateralized assets. In contrast, centralized stablecoins such as USDC are backed by traditional reserves.
Synthetic Assets
Protocols like Synthetix enable the creation of synthetic assets that mirror the value of real-world assets, such as stocks, commodities, or fiat currencies. This allows global investors to gain exposure to traditional markets without intermediaries.
Insurance
DeFi insurance platforms such as Nexus Mutual provide coverage against risks like smart contract failures or exchange hacks. By pooling resources from participants, these platforms offer decentralized alternatives to traditional insurance models.
Asset Management
Protocols like Yearn Finance automate yield optimization strategies, helping users maximize returns across multiple DeFi platforms without manually managing each investment.
Examples of Popular DeFi Platforms
Ethereum – The primary blockchain supporting DeFi, hosting thousands of dApps.
MakerDAO – Pioneer in decentralized lending and stablecoin creation (DAI).
Uniswap – Leading decentralized exchange using AMMs to enable trading.
Aave – A lending protocol offering innovative features like flash loans.
Compound – A platform that democratized lending and borrowing in crypto.
Curve Finance – Specializes in stablecoin trading with minimal slippage.
Synthetix – Enables users to trade synthetic assets.
Nexus Mutual – Offers decentralized insurance products.
Advantages of DeFi
Financial Inclusion – DeFi removes barriers to entry, allowing unbanked populations worldwide to access financial services.
Cost Efficiency – By eliminating intermediaries, DeFi reduces transaction costs.
Transparency – Public blockchains ensure that all activity is auditable.
Global Accessibility – DeFi operates on the internet, unrestricted by national boundaries.
Innovation – Open-source protocols foster experimentation and rapid development of new financial products.
Risks and Challenges
Despite its potential, DeFi faces several significant challenges:
Security Risks – Vulnerabilities in smart contracts can lead to hacks and losses. High-profile breaches have cost users billions of dollars.
Regulatory Uncertainty – Governments worldwide are grappling with how to regulate DeFi without stifling innovation.
Scalability Issues – Most DeFi protocols rely on Ethereum, which struggles with network congestion and high fees.
Market Volatility – Over-collateralization and sudden price swings expose participants to liquidation risks.
Complexity – Many DeFi products are difficult for average users to understand, limiting mainstream adoption.
Regulation and the Future of DeFi
Regulators are increasingly paying attention to DeFi due to concerns about consumer protection, money laundering, and systemic risks. Some countries are exploring frameworks that balance innovation with oversight.
For example, the U.S. Securities and Exchange Commission (SEC) has begun examining DeFi platforms for compliance with securities laws.
At the same time, institutional investors are showing growing interest in DeFi, with traditional financial institutions exploring ways to integrate decentralized systems. Layer-2 scaling solutions, such as Optimism and Arbitrum, are addressing scalability issues, while cross-chain protocols are expanding interoperability beyond Ethereum.
The future of DeFi likely lies in a hybrid model, combining decentralized innovation with regulatory compliance, fostering both safety and inclusivity.
